Configure the IP Address with RS-232
The SKA-3D supports IP-based control using Telnet or the built-in web interface. Use RS-232 to
configure the network settings. This table lists the default network settings for the SKA-3D:
1. Connect one end of the RS-232 cable to the RS-232 port on the back of the SKA-3D and the
other end to the computer port.
See Rear Panel on page 7.
2. Start a terminal emulation program. For example, HyperTerminal.
Use the RS-232 Settings on page 35 to configure the program.
3. Configure the IP address:
ipaddr [SKA-3D_IP_Address]
4. Configure the subnet mask:
subnet [SKA-3D_Subnet_Mask]
5. Configure the gateway (router) IP address:
gateway [Gateway_IP_Address]
6. Configure the telnet listening port:
telnetport [Telnet_Listening_Port]
7. Configure the HTTP listening port:
httpport [HTTP_Listening_Port]
8. Reboot the SKA-3D to reset the IP address changes.
Specification Setting
IP Address 192.168.206.100
Subnet mask 255.255.255.0
Default Gateway 192.168.206.1
HTTP port 80
Telnet port 23
